For the Brits: an idiom question

 I'm trying to find just the correct way to explain the meaning of "hit someone for six." I know the technical cricket definition, but I'm struggling to put the idiom into words. "Devastate" seems too harsh, "inconvenience" is too mild.  I'm trying to get at the meaning of putting someone in an unfortunate position, but I'm not sure that's quite right either. I could use some suggestions, as it's a pretty important line in a story.

Thanks in advance.

468 ad

Leave a Reply